To keep in mind:

• Avoid harsh sunlight, sunbathing and tanning beds

• If you must go in the sun, wear sunscreen

• Avoid topical face treatments

• Avoid swimming in chlorinated water

• Avoid profuse sweating

• Avoid touching the area

How long will your face or brow wax last?

Typically, your wax will last 2-3 weeks before you begin to see any regrowth, but as you wax your face more regularly, the density and amount of hair will decrease. 

Additional Exfoliation Benefits

  • Exfoliating primes the skin for waxing by making it easier for hairs to slide out from their roots, which can create longer lasting results.

  • Exfoliating helps the skin on your face better absorb your moisturizer and serums, which means they'll work more effectively.

  • Regular exfoliation reduces your chance of ingrown hairs—great for anyone prone to ingrown hairs on their chin and neck.
